UGANDA: Lukodi Sanitation Project
Drop toilets: $30 each
Lukodi is a village of 1,000 households in Northern Uganda. In 2004 it was the site of a devastating massacre which forced people into the bush and away from their homes. Today people are returning to the area and the Di-Cwinyi Women’s Self Help Group, a community group of over 300 members, is committed to rebuilding the community with Bright Futures help. There is an urgent need to build toilets in the area and funds are being sought to provide materials
for this work. The people of Lukodi will use local labour to build drop toilets which will benefit 1,000 families, making their communities healthier by kerbing the spread of preventable diseases.

INDIA: Medical Clinics in Quarry Villages
Medicines: $5 per person
Bright Futures partner, the Bangalore City Mission, provides life changing development programs that bring help and hope to impoverished children, families and communities in more than 20 quarry villages and poor communities in India. Facilitating medical camps at which many thousands of needy people are seen by local doctors each year is an important health initiative that makes a real difference in people’s lives. For many, it is the first time they have seen a doctor. Provision of facilities and medications for those being treated is critically important and this cost is met through the Bright Futures / Bangalore City Mission partnership and costs, on average, just $5 per person.

PAKISTAN: Education
School books and uniforms: $50 per child
In Pakistan, Bright Futures partner the Christian Fellowship of Pakistan (CFP), is helping break the cycle of poverty by providing opportunities for poor children to obtain an education. Without education the opportunities for future employment are very limited. The CFP school provides schooling for nearly 300 students, both
boys and girls, many of whom are orphans. Over the past year CFP has focused a great deal of its resources toward responding to the terrible floods that resulted in displacement of millions and the widespread loss of life.
